General information
- The minimum stand size is 9 sq m (3 x 3 meters)
- Exhibition space will be allocated as “space only”, that is, without any prefabricated walls, installations, furniture, carpet, electricity or any other technical supplies.
- For 9 sq m (3 x 3 meters) stands, standard shell scheme, IDF will provide the space with prefabricated walls as separation between stands. The standard shell scheme includes: carpet, 2 spot lights, 2 basic shelves, 1 table and 2 chairs.
- The max. stand height is 5 meters. Double-decker stands as well as platform stands over 2.5 meters are not allowed.
- All peninsula, corner and in-line stands must be separated from the neighbouring stand (s) by means of a separation wall. Over 2.5 meters, the separation wall should be finished or open.
- Allocated exhibition floor space does not include the rental of shell schemes or any other facilities and services.

Cancellation/reduction of exhibition space
The exhibitor cancelling or reducing his reservation of exhibition space after his official application has been accepted will be liable to pay the following fees.
- If the space can be reallocated to another company, the exhibitor will receive a full refund of deposits paid, less an administrative fee representing 10% of the total fee, minimum 100 EUR.
- If the space cannot be reallocated to another company, the company cancelling the reservation will have to pay the full fee.
Any refunds of deposits paid will be made after the congress but no later than 31 December 2009. The exhibitor will not be entitled to any interest that the organizer may have derived from the deposits. All bank charges, including sender’s and receiver’s charges, resulting from a refund related to cancellation or reduction of exhibition space will be at the charge of the exhibitor.
